Trotz der Entfernung können Sie die Navigationsleiste und den Sperrbildschirm in Android oder DP3 immer noch anpassen – so geht's

click fraud protection

Android O Developer Preview 3 entfernt die Anpassung der Navigationsleiste und der Sperrbildschirmverknüpfungen; Hier erfahren Sie, wie Sie sie noch anpassen können.

Die Android O Developer Preview ist jetzt verfügbar erreichte seine dritte VeröffentlichungDies bedeutet, dass die endgültigen APIs fertig sind und Google sich auf eine baldige Veröffentlichung vorbereitet, wobei in der verbleibenden Entwicklervorschau nur kleinere Fehlerbehebungen zu erwarten sind. Bei früheren Android O-Vorschauen haben wir jede Menge Verbesserungen an der Benutzeroberfläche gesehen und einige davon Zusätzliche Anpassungsfunktionen, von denen einige wahrscheinlich getestet wurden und möglicherweise später nicht verfügbar sind Veröffentlichungen.

Tatsächlich haben Benutzer berichtet, dass mit Android O DP3, Anpassung der Sperrbildschirm-Verknüpfung Und Anpassung der Navigationsleiste haben Beide wurden aus dem System-UI-Tuner entfernt, was darauf hindeutet, dass sie es tatsächlich nicht als benutzerorientierte Funktionen in die stabile Version von Android O schaffen werden. Das heißt aber nicht, dass sie nicht immer noch zugänglich sind – tatsächlich ist die Anpassung der Navigationsleiste seit Nougat in AOSP inaktiv.

habe mich die ganze Zeit dort versteckt. Obwohl die Funktion also nicht neu war, experimentierte Google mit der Einführung für Endbenutzer, indem sie sie im System-UI-Tuner platzierte, wo sich alle versteckten, experimentellen Funktionen befanden. Obwohl wir das Glück hatten, die neuen Navigationsleisten- und Sperrbildschirmfunktionen zu erhalten, die in der ersten Android O Developer Preview eingeführt wurden, wissen wir nicht, wann wir diese Funktionen wieder erhalten werden. Höchstwahrscheinlich werden sie in der offiziellen Version nicht einmal standardmäßig aktiviert sein, möglicherweise nicht einmal im System-UI-Tuner.

Zum Glück ist es so Es ist immer noch möglich, diese Funktionen zu manipulieren ohne auf die offizielle Schnittstelle zugreifen zu müssen. Überraschung, Überraschung, es wurden nur die benutzerorientierten Menüs entfernt, was bedeutet, dass Sie diese Funktionen weiterhin nutzen können, wenn Sie Ihren Android O DP3-Build anpassen möchten. Es ist wahrscheinlich, dass die unten beschriebene inoffizielle Methode auch bei der offiziellen Veröffentlichung funktioniert, es sei denn, Google entfernt den Code vollständig Verantwortlich für die Funktion aus dem System UI APK, halten Sie diese Anleitung also griffbereit für den Fall, dass Sie nicht auf die Vorschau zugreifen können, aber damit experimentieren möchten später. Wenn Sie Nougat verwenden, können Sie je nach ROM jetzt mit der Anpassung der Navigationsleiste experimentieren.

Anforderungen: Dieses Handbuch richtet sich an Benutzer, die Android O Developer Preview 3 ausführen. Derzeit umfasst dies das Nexus 5X, das Nexus 6P, den Nexus Player, Pixel C, Google Pixel und Google Pixel XL. Die Anpassung der Sperrbildschirmverknüpfung ist auf diesen Geräten mit Android Nougat nicht verfügbar, die Anpassung der Navigationsleiste jedoch schon.


Ändern der Navigationsleiste – Anwendungsmethode

Originaler Artikel

Installieren Benutzerdefinierter Navigationsleisten-Tuner Und Melden Sie sich für den Betatest an um alle neuesten Funktionen zu erhalten. Öffnen Sie die Anwendung und folgen Sie den Bildschirmen, um eine Anleitung zur Einrichtung zu erhalten. Sie fordert die Berechtigung WRITE_SECURE_SETTINGS an und erklärt zwei Möglichkeiten, wie Sie sie erteilen können.

Sofern Ihr Telefon nicht gerootet ist, müssen Sie diese Berechtigung über eine ADB-Shell erteilen. Dazu müssen Sie Folgendes tun Laden Sie die ADB-Binärdatei herunter für Ihr bestimmtes Betriebssystem sowie die Google USB-Treiber wenn Sie Windows verwenden. Aktivieren Sie als Nächstes die Entwickleroptionen, indem Sie zu Einstellungen -> Über das Telefon gehen und sieben Mal auf Build-Nummer tippen. Öffnen Sie dann die Entwickleroptionen in den Einstellungen (Sie werden aufgefordert, die PIN/das Passwort Ihres Telefons einzugeben) und aktivieren Sie das USB-Debugging. Schließen Sie Ihr Telefon an Ihren PC an, öffnen Sie eine Eingabeaufforderung/ein Terminal, in dem Sie Ihre ADB-Binärdatei gespeichert haben, und geben Sie dann ein adb devices. Ihr Telefon wird Sie dazu auffordern, den ADB-Zugriff zu aktivieren – gewähren Sie ihn, dann wird die Seriennummer Ihres Telefons in der Eingabeaufforderung/im Terminal angezeigt.

Jetzt können Sie den Befehl eingeben, um die erforderliche Berechtigung zu erteilen, wie in der App „Benutzerdefinierte Navigationsleiste“ erwähnt. Nachdem Sie der App diese Berechtigung erteilt haben, führen Sie einen Kompatibilitätstest durch, bei dem die Anwendung versucht, Ihre Navigationsleiste zu ändern. Wenn der Vorgang erfolgreich ist, können Sie fortfahren und auf das Hauptmenü zugreifen.

Neuanordnung der Navigationsleistenschaltflächen

Mit der Anwendung lässt sich die Navigationsleiste ganz einfach neu anordnen. Stellen Sie sicher, dass Sie ein Betatester sind, um die oben genannten experimentellen Funktionen nutzen zu können. Sie finden einen Abschnitt namens experimentelle Optimierungen, greifen Sie darauf zu, um die Optionen anzuzeigen, mit denen Sie Ihre drei vorhandenen Schlüssel ersetzen können. Sie können die Reihenfolge ändern oder sie nach Ihren Wünschen ändern. Die App ist sehr intuitiv und Sie sollten keine Probleme damit haben, zu einem Setup zu gelangen, mit dem Sie zufrieden sind.

Andere Verwendungsmöglichkeiten der benutzerdefinierten Navigationsleiste

Die benutzerdefinierte Navigationsleisten-App verfügt über unzählige Funktionen, also erkunden Sie ihre Angebote selbst! Hier sind nur zwei frühere Tutorials, die ich geschrieben habe und die zeigen, wie Sie die Tasker-Integration (eine Profi-Funktion) der App für nützliche Situationen nutzen können.

  • So fügen Sie der Navigationsleiste beim Abspielen von Musik Steuerelemente für die Medienwiedergabe hinzu
  • So fügen Sie während der Texteingabe linke/rechte Tastaturcursor zur Navigationsleiste hinzu

Da die App die Möglichkeit bietet, Tasker-Ereignisse auszulösen, können Sie die Tasten der Navigationsleiste technisch so programmieren, dass sie in jeder gewünschten Situation nahezu jede erdenkliche Aktion ausführen.


Anpassung des Sperrbildschirms mit ADB

Glücklicherweise ist diese Funktion sehr einfach, da außer dem Hinzufügen einer Verknüpfung keine großen Anpassungsmöglichkeiten bestehen. Sperrbildschirmverknüpfungen sind sehr nützlich und Googles Ansatz im System UI Tuner war ziemlich leistungsfähig – er ermöglichte Ihnen nicht nur dies Wählen Sie Anwendungsverknüpfungen, aber auch spezifische Aktivitäten verschiedener Anwendungen, die alle zusammen mit Symbolen intuitiv aufgelistet sind Speisekarte. Dieser Ansatz ist zwar nicht ganz so intuitiv und zugänglich, aber er bleibt ziemlich einfach und Sie können ihn nutzen Fügen Sie weiterhin Verknüpfungen zu jeder App-Aktivität hinzu mit ADB. Sie müssen lediglich ADB-Shell-Befehle mit der folgenden Synax weitergeben:

Für die linke Taste:

settings put secure sysui_keyguard_left "COMPONENT/NAME"

Für den richtigen Schlüssel:

settings put secure sysui_keyguard_right "COMPONENT/NAME"

Wo COMPONENT bezieht sich auf den Paketnamen der Anwendung und NAME bezieht sich auf den Aktivitätsnamen innerhalb des Pakets. Wenn ich beispielsweise die Hauptaktivität von Hangouts auf der linken Seite starten wollte, würde ich Folgendes eingeben:

settings put secure sysui_keyguard_left "com.google.android.talk/com.google.android.apps.hangouts.phone.BabelHomeActivity"

Wenn Sie abschließend anpassen möchten, ob die Verknüpfungen für den linken oder rechten Sperrbildschirm auch automatisch den Sperrbildschirm umgehen, können Sie die folgenden Befehle eingeben:

settings put secure sysui_keyguard_left_unlock 0/1

settings put secure sysui_keyguard_right_unlock 0/1

Dabei bedeutet 0, dass die Verknüpfung das Telefon nicht entsperrt, und 1, dass die Verknüpfung das Telefon entsperrt.

Bleibt nur noch die Frage: Wie in aller Welt finde ich heraus, welche spezifische Aktivität eines Pakets ich möchte und wie heißt diese Aktivität, die ich in den Befehl eingeben muss? Glücklicherweise können diese Informationen mit Hilfe von jedem ganz intuitiv gesammelt werden Aktivitätsstarter-Anwendungoder das Aktivitätsstarter-Widget im beliebten Nova Launcher, den Sie möglicherweise auf Ihrem Gerät verwenden. Suchen Sie einfach die gewünschte Anwendung und durchsuchen Sie deren Aktivitäten. Sie werden wahrscheinlich den gewünschten Bildschirm finden.


Der Himmel ist das Limit

Es ist traurig zu sehen, dass die zugängliche, benutzerorientierte Oberfläche zum Anpassen dieser Funktionen aus dem verschwindet neueste Entwicklervorschau, da dies ihren möglichen Untergang mit dem offiziellen Android 8.0 signalisiert freigeben. Wie Sie jedoch sehen, ist es auch ohne die GUI in der System-Benutzeroberfläche weiterhin möglich, auf die zugrunde liegende Funktionalität zuzugreifen Tuner, was bedeutet, dass Sie hoffentlich weiterhin in der Lage sein werden, die Navigationsleiste und die Verknüpfungen für den Sperrbildschirm zu optimieren, sobald O herauskommt. Lassen Sie nicht zu, dass dieser eingeschränkte Leitfaden diese Funktionen unterschätzt: die Die Möglichkeiten sind endlos, da Sie dem Sperrbildschirm nicht nur Verknüpfungen zu jeder Aktivität hinzufügen können, sondern mit der Verwendung von Tastencodes auch alle möglichen Funktionen hinzufügen können, z Medienkontrollen, Navigieren Sie durch E-Mails, durch die Seiten scrollen und mehr. Wenn Sie ein Fan meiner vorherigen sind Tasker-TutorialsDann finden Sie unzählige Möglichkeiten, diese Funktionen zu nutzen und das Beste aus Ihrem Gerät herauszuholen.


Was halten Sie von diesen Funktionen und ihrer Entfernung? Haben Sie Fragen? Hinterlasse einen Kommentar.